The country was abuzz with talk over the sweltering heat. “Iyi ndiyo climate change chaiyo,” a young woman remarked fanning himself with a hat in a street in the city centre. But does a mere variation in temperature mean that Zimbabwe is now experiencing climate change?

A workshop held recently on climate change organised by the Community technology Development Trust (a local NGO) was a good one to check on how seasonal climate variations is stacking up against expectations. People’s perception of climate change usually differ from the one held by academics and the scientific community.
To most people, the fact that temperatures hit the 46 degree barrier in Chiredzi and Buffalo Range is a sure indicator of climate change in Zimbabwe.

But for scientists, it is not enough to conclude that Zimbabwe is now experiencing climate change because of this sudden upsurge in temperature.
“An extreme event is sometimes confused with climate change, although there might be some correlations, but this does not necessarily mean a changed climate,” said Tirivanhu Muhwati, a weather expert from the Zimbabwe Meteorological Services Department.
“We should not confuse temperature variations with climate change.”

Climate change, he said, can be described as an identifiable statistical change in the state of the climate which persists for an extended period of time while climate variation referred to variations in the mean state and other statistics relating to the climate on all temporal and spatial scales beyond that of individual weather events.
“For example, Harare has an average mean rainfall of 600mm per year and if this mean falls to 550mm then we can conclude that climate change has taken place. If this mean (600mm) does not change over say a 30-year period, then no climate change has taken place,” the weather expert said.

Muhwati presented statistical figures on rainfall patterns from around the 1900s to 2010 as well as temperature patterns from 1962 to 2008. Zimbabwe is increasingly experiencing temperature changes as a result of global warming or global climate disruption, as some meteorologists would argue.
The Zimbabwe average minimum temperatures increased from 13 degrees Celsius in 1962 to 14 degrees Celsius by 2008 while average maximum temperatures went up from 26 degrees Celsius in 1962 to 27,2 degrees Celsius by 2008.

“Debate is healthy as it helps us to do better analysis. The temperature data base goes back to 1962. Zimbabwe is experiencing a gradual increase in temperatures – year to year variability. It’s showing an increasing trend,” he said.
“One of the most contentious issues in the climate change debate is attribution. We need to prove that climate change is really taking place. The link is very difficult to explain. What evidence do you have that warming is causing a decrease in rainfall. This is what climate skeptics normally ask us.”

A University of Zimbabwe – CTDT study report on the perception of smallholder farmers from UMP, Murehwa, Chiredzi and Tsholotsho of climate change indicated that the most prominent feature they identified as a sign of climate change included rainfall distribution – change in rainfall patterns in the last 30 years, changes in temperature, changes in forest vegetation, recurrent droughts and very high ambient temperature, drying up of water sources, warm winter season and the extension of the winter season.

“This is how they perceive climate change to be taking place. We had to conduct research to verify their perceptions with data on climate change from the Met Office,” said Dr Emmanuel Mashonjowa of the UZ Agri-Meteorology Department.
“In all districts, farmers stated that rainfall amounts, and distribution, have changed in the past ten years. They say there has been a general decline in the rainfall amounts, recurrent droughts, drastic changes in the rainfall distribution – delayed onset dates of the rainy season and increased frequency and length of mid-season dry spells.”

Farmers, he also said, stated that the climate had become warmer in recent years with higher than normal day time temperatures, warm nights and warm winter seasons.

“Farmers’ perceptions of climate change generally agree with findings of analyses of rainfall and temperature data. These show that in the last 20-30 years, there has been an increase in rainfall variability and frequency and severity of droughts,” Dr Mashonjowa said.

Generally, according to the UZ-CTDT study, there was an observed delay in the onset dates of the rainy season in Chiredzi and UMP, shortening of the length of the growing period in these districts something that tallied with farmers’ perceptions. Findings also suggest that there was general warming of temperatures in all the three districts by about 0,3 to 0,4 Degrees Celsius and that most of the warming occurred during the period after 1980 – the period with higher than usual occurrences of droughts.
